  The working principle of a one way solenoid valve is based on the electromagnetic force generated by a solenoid coil. When an electrical current passes through the coil, it creates a magnetic field that attracts a plunger, which in turn opens or closes the valve. This action is achieved through the use of a diaphragm or a ball, which is connected to the plunger and controls the flow of fluid. The valve remains in its set position until the electrical current is removed, ensuring consistent and reliable performance.

  One way solenoid valves come in various types, including poppet valves, diaphragm valves, and ball valves, each with its unique advantages and applications. Poppet valves are commonly used in high-pressure systems, while diaphragm valves are suitable for low-pressure applications. Ball valves, on the other hand, offer a full port design and are ideal for use in systems with high flow rates.
